Ombudsman urges GreenSquareAccord to make further improvements to complaint handling

greensquareaccord_cricklade-236

The Housing Ombudsman has told the housing association it needs to address the ‘root causes’ of complaints

The Housing Ombudsman has urged GreenSquareAccord to continue to strengthen its complaint handling processes and address the root causes of complaints, such as property conditions. 

A new special report into GreenSquareAccord (GSA) found that the housing association had a 93% maladministration rate for complaint handling in the cases reviewed, against a national average of 76% for housing associations.

The Ombudsman’s investigation revealed that the housing association had a maladministration rate of 79% for property condition, compared to a national average of 54%.
